WILKIE, James Bygone Fife, North of the Lomonds £25.00 1 in stock Bygone Fife, North of the Lomonds quantity Add to basket
MYLNE, Christopher Foula: The Time of My Life £18.00 1 in stock Foula: The Time of My Life quantity Add to basket